## Configuration

The ConsentCurtain banner rollout is driven entirely by environment configuration so reviewers can audit behavior without reading template code. Region targeting, ramp percentage, and banner copy version are all plain variables documented in `CONFIG.md`. One value is sensitive: the policy-service credential that authorizes consent-state writes. It must never appear in committed files or review diffs. To enable writes locally, place the following line in your untracked env file.

vault entry, yahif-yajep: COURIER_KEY29=b802bdf8034096b65a51c6ba5abe2

FAQ: Why did my SQL file fail CI?

The Grindle linter enforces uppercase keywords, explicit column lists (no SELECT *), and a trailing newline. Migrations also require a rollback block. Warnings became errors after the Q3 cleanup, so older files may newly fail. Run the linter locally before pushing. The full rule list and suppression syntax are on the page below.

runbook for badug-kadup: https://confluence.zemvarlabs.internal/projects/browse/display/projects/bd1b

### Notes — DocSweep Linter Sync

Quick recap: DocSweep now catches broken anchors and stale code fences, and we turned the heading-case rule back on (sorry, everyone). False positives on tables are down after last week's patch. Rule configs live in the shared lint repo — don't fork them, just open a proposal. If you're maintaining this later and something's weird, ping the person named below.

named custodian: Brivan Eliath Quenox Frador